The Lowdown on Legalities: Are You Actually Allowed to Sleep at the Airport?

Let’s start with the burning question: is it even legal to sleep in an airport? The short answer is—yes, you can. Most public airports welcome snoozers as long as you aren’t causing a scene or blocking emergency exits. However, rules may vary by airport, country, and even by terminal. If the airport management believes you’re more than just a weary traveler—say, if you’re camping out in restricted zones or latching yourself to a power outlet—you might just get a friendly (or not-so-friendly) wake-up call from security.

Here are a few things to keep in mind:

  • Public vs. Private Areas: Sleeping is generally allowed in public lounge areas, but some airports may restrict sleeping in VIP lounges or private transit areas, so always check signage or ask a staff member.
  • Local and National Laws: In some regions, local ordinances might limit overnight stays in public buildings, while in other places, airport authorities have the freedom to enforce their own policies.
  • Behavior Matters: Even if you’re allowed to sleep, maintaining respectful behavior goes a long way. Keep your belongings in check and be courteous to fellow travelers and airport staff.

Ultimately, the golden rule is pretty simple: if you’re quiet, respectful, and aware of your surroundings, airport sleeping can be a totally legal and surprisingly comfortable way to catch some sleep on a long journey.

If you’re ready to transition from restless pacing to restful napping in the terminal, consider these pro tips to find the best spots. Every airport has that one zone that’s just begging for a power nap—if you know where to look.

Strategic Sleeping Zones

  • Quiet Corners: Look for less-trafficked terminal corners, often near gates that aren’t bustling with boarding announcements. These areas are golden for catching short naps.
  • Designated Rest Areas: Some airports, like Singapore Changi and Helsinki-Vantaa, actually offer designated sleeping areas with reclining chairs and soft lighting designed specifically for snoozers.
  • Airport Lounges: If you have access to an airport lounge—via a membership or a credit card perk—they’re usually well-equipped with comfy seating, dim lights, and even complimentary snacks.
  • Hidden Gems: Use apps and reviews to pinpoint secret napping spots. Fellow travelers often share their discoveries on platforms like Instagram and travel forums.

Essential Gear for Terminal Nappers

To optimize your airport sleeping experience, a little planning goes a long way. Here’s what to pack in your carry-on:

  • Portable Pillow or Neck Rest: A compact, travel-friendly cushion can transform a rigid seat into a supportive nap pad.
  • Eye Mask and Earplugs: Block out the glaring terminal lights and distracting announcements to create your own pocket of darkness and silence.
  • Travel Blanket or Wrap: Air-conditioned terminals can sometimes feel like an arctic tundra. Stay cozy by having a light, warm blanket at hand.
  • Charged Power Bank: Keeping your devices charged ensures you stay connected and can even use soothing sounds or sleep apps during your downtime.
  • Snack Pack: A few healthy snacks can keep you energized if your layover turns into a lengthy wait.

Mixing these practical tips with your unique travel style can transform an impromptu terminal sleep into a restful, even rejuvenating, experience.

The Rise of Airport Sleeping Pods: Next-Level Napping Spots for Modern Travelers

When we talk about sleeping in airports, we’d be remiss not to mention the star of the show: airport sleeping pods. These high-tech, futuristic mini-sleeping stations are gradually popping up in airports worldwide, offering travelers a sweet spot between budget-friendly naps and the extravagance of an airport hotel.

Airport sleeping pods are designed for travelers by travelers. They come in various shapes and sizes—from soundproof, enclosed capsules to semi-private seating areas equipped with charging stations, adjustable lighting, and even built-in entertainment systems. They offer a level of comfort and privacy that far surpasses the standard terminal bench, making them a highly coveted commodity among budget-conscious and tech-savvy wanderers alike.

Benefits of Using an Airport Sleeping Pod

  • Privacy and Security: These pods often have a locking door or privacy screen, so you can relax without worrying about your belongings.
  • Enhanced Comfort: With ergonomic designs, cushioned seating, and sometimes even a breathable blanket, sleeping pods are engineered for maximum comfort during short naps.
  • Tech-Forward Features: Enjoy built-in USB ports, mood lighting, and on-demand soundscapes that transport you into a world of relaxation, away from the constant hustle of the terminal.
  • Hygiene and Cleanliness: Many pods undergo regular cleaning and sanitizing—an important perk in today’s health-conscious travel environment.

While these sleeping pods might come with a price tag, they are often more affordable than booking an impromptu night in a hotel. Plus, their sleek design and high-tech amenities resonate perfectly with the Gen-Z and millennial desire for convenience, comfort, and aesthetic appeal.

Safety First: Navigating Airport Security and Staying Comfortable Overnight

As much as we love the idea of carefree napping in the airport, safety and security are still top priorities. Airports are, after all, high-security spaces with countless cameras, patrols, and a constant flurry of activity. Whether you’re sprawled across a quiet bench or tucked into a cozy sleeping pod, here’s how to make sure you (and your belongings) are as safe as they are comfortable:

Stay Visible, Not Vulnerable

It’s a delicate balancing act between blending into the background and remaining visible enough to deter any sketchy behavior. In many airports, sleeping in plain sight is your best bet. Set up near a busy terminal area where there is plenty of movement—but avoid obstructing passageways or emergency exits.

Secure Your Essentials

Never let your valuables become an easy target. Use a travel pouch or anti-theft bag to keep your passport, money, and smartphone close to your body. If you’re the type who can fall asleep anywhere, consider using a portable travel safe or even a lockable bag that can be looped around your chair.

Know the Rules, Respect the Space

Much like any public space, airports have their own etiquette. While many terminals are cool with a few years’ worth of sleep, setting up camp in unauthorized areas (like restricted zones) might earn you a not-so-friendly visit from airport security. When in doubt, a quick check-in with airport staff can clarify where it’s cool to lay your head.

Stay Connected

In today’s digital age, staying connected is not just about entertainment—it’s a crucial safety net. Make sure your phone is fully charged (and keep that power bank handy) so you can call for help if needed, track your flight updates, or simply stream some calming sounds to ease you into sleep.

Combining these safety tips with your personal flair ensures that your airport sleep adventure remains chill, secure, and above all—fun.

Pro Tips to Upgrade Your Airport Sleep Game

Now that we’ve navigated the ins and outs of airport sleeping, it’s time to drop some pro tips that will take your terminal snoozing skills from “meh” to “masterclass.”

When to Plan Your Sleep

Timing is everything. If you know your flight has a lengthy delay or if you’re stuck at a connecting flight for over five hours, plan your sleep schedule accordingly. A well-timed power nap can actually boost your energy levels and keep those travel blues at bay.

Embrace the Art of Micro-Napping

Not every airport nap will be a full-blown deep sleep session. Micro-naps lasting 20-30 minutes can help refresh you without plunging you into full sleep inertia. These short bursts work wonders for recharging your mental batteries without the groggy aftermath.

Customize Your Sleep Setup

Bring along items that make the unfamiliar feel a bit more homely—a favorite travel pillow, that quirky eye mask you snagged on sale, or even a compact sleep aid app that plays soothing visuals and sounds. Personal touches can make a huge difference in setting the right sleep vibe.

Scout the Terminal in Advance

If you’re a frequent flyer, make it a mission to scout out the best rest areas in your chosen airport before your trip. Check online travel forums, read recent reviews, and navigate the terminal layout via the airport’s official website. Knowing what to expect can transform a potential sleep struggle into a serene respite.

Mindset is Key

Perhaps the most underrated tip is to adopt the right mindset. Embrace the spontaneity of airport sleeping with a relaxed attitude. Instead of stressing over the less-than-ideal surroundings, view it as part of the adventure—a story waiting to be shared at your next get-together.

With these pro tips in your travel arsenal, not only will you conquer the airport sleep scene, but you might even find that terminal napping becomes your secret weapon for turning long layovers into mini-retreats.

Playing It Smart: Navigating Airport Amenities and Lounges

While the idea of sleeping on a hard bench with a travel pillow might have been trendy a decade ago, today’s airports are rolling out a whole suite of amenities to cater to the weary traveler. From exclusive lounges to budget-friendly day rooms, there’s a plethora of options if you’re looking for an upgrade.

Exclusive Airport Lounges

Many airports offer lounge access either as part of a premium ticket package or through membership programs. These lounges come equipped with ultra-comfy seating, complimentary food and drinks, shower facilities, and even dedicated quiet zones. So if you have that credit card perk or an upgrade voucher, why not indulge in a brief escape from the chaos of your terminal?

Day Rooms and Transit Hotels

Some airports now feature transit hotels or day rooms that you can book by the hour. These spaces are perfect if you need a complete break from the hustle for a few hours, offering everything from a private bed to a full-service shower. It’s like having a mini-vacation right on airport grounds.

Pay-Per-Use Sleeping Pods

As mentioned earlier, sleeping pods are a rising star in the airport landscape. They typically operate on a pay-per-use basis, allowing you to book a private, cozy space for a few hours. It’s a modern solution that merges affordability with the high-tech comforts that today’s travelers crave.

Other Hidden Amenities

Don’t overlook other hidden gems, such as designated rest zones with reclining seats, prayer rooms that double as calm retreats, or even innovative “quiet zones” designed by cutting-edge architects to provide a haven away from the buzz of daily travel.

Leveraging these amenities not only pampers you but also underscores the idea that airport sleeping doesn’t have to be a last-resort option—it can be a strategic part of your travel experience.
